智能封锁雷自修复策略研究
引用本文:王建平,焦国太,刘彩花.智能封锁雷自修复策略研究[J].科学技术与工程,2013,13(3):588-592,605.
作者姓名:王建平  焦国太  刘彩花
作者单位:中北大学机电工程学院,太原,030051
摘    要:针对机场全局封锁问题,以弹跳式智能雷为研究对象,对智能雷全局封锁机场过程中三角形队列的形成、破坏和自修复进行了研究和算法设计。并以Window XP为仿真平台,Visual C++6.0为开发工具,编写相应程序,实现整个运动过程的模拟仿真,得到了理想的结果。

关 键 词:智能封锁雷  自修复  三角形队列  全局封锁  模拟仿真
